The mix of family homes and waterfront properties here means salt exposure is a real factor in what gets planted. Choosing salt-tolerant varieties and siting them out of the worst wind is the difference between a garden that establishes and one that struggles — exactly the kind of judgment call I bring to every Brooklyn job.
